Enhancing Damage Tolerance of Structures Using 3D/4D Printing Technologies
This review highlights recent advances in damage tolerance for structural design, emphasizing safety, durability, and reliability in fields like aerospace and civil engineering. It covers innovations in materials, 3D/4D printing, predictive design methods, and nature‐inspired strategies.

Focused ion beam (FIB) patterning enables on‐chip amorphization of high‐aspect ratio MoS2 monolayers into complex geometries with tunable electrical properties. By controlling the ion dose, conductive pathways as narrow as 700 nm are formed, allowing precise modulation of local conductivity.

This work quantifies chirality through the continuous chirality measure (CCM). The CCM is correlated to a variety of properties: spin‐orbit field, orbital angular momentum, circular dichroism, absorption dissymmetry factor (gCD) and the circular photogalvanic effect.
